Title:
SELECTOR FOR LEARNING COIN OR THE LIKE
Document Type and Number:
Japanese Patent JPS5927383
Kind Code:
A
Abstract:
A method and apparatus for discriminating coins or bank notes are disclosed, which use sensors 3, 10, 17 for measuring characteristics of coins or bank notes and processing control means 23-32 capable of providing a reference value setting mode and a discriminating mode. In the reference value setting mode, data of sample coins or bank notes obtained from the sensors 3, 10, 17 are statistically processed to calculate minimum and maximum reference values, and these values are stored in a memory 28. In the discrimination mode, a coin or bank note is discriminated as to its authenticity through checks as to whether its characteristic data obtained from the sensors are within the minimum and maximum reference values.
